[0078] The control effect test of the herbicide mixture of the present invention (mixture of diquat dibromide and glufosinate-ammonium) on annual weeds and perennial weeds in non-agricultural land

[0079] Test purpose

[0080] The purpose of this study is to select the excellent control agents for annual weeds and perennial weeds in non-agricultural land and the expression mechanism of drug efficacy in specific areas.

[0081] Test method

[0082] 1. Object weeds: annual weeds and perennial weeds in non-agricultural land

[0083] 2. The occurrence of the target weeds: barnyard tares, amaranth, amaranth, humulus japonicus, thorn lettuce, wormwood, sorrel, creeping ice grass, white aster, etc. are produced, so as to fully judge the weeding effect.

[0166] Composition of the herbicide mixture according to the present invention (mixture of diquat dibromide and glufosinate-ammonium) Comparison of quick-acting effects of combined control

[0167] In this experiment, the effect of herbicides was increased in a greenhouse environment, so herbicides were used according to the ratio of the fields reduced. The ratios tested are chosen in such a way that when the herbicides are used alone about 50 to 70% control, all synergistic effects can be easily detected when the mixture is tested. The same test conditions as in Example 1 above were used.

[0168] Prepare a combination of diquat dibromide and glufosinate-ammonium mixture with different ratios

Abstract

The present invention relates to a herbicide mixture having a synergistic action, and more particularly, to a synergistic herbicide mixture including: diquat dibromide and nonselective herbicide; a herbicide composition including the herbicide mixture as an active ingredient; and a weed control method using same. The herbicide mixture of the present invention is characterized in that diquat dibromide and glufosinate ammonium are mixed at a certain ratio, thereby showing 80% or more of a herbicidal effect on various weeds and plants, and a herbicidal activity lasting at least 30 days, as well as a rapid herbicidal activity of 6 to 23 hours (within one day), on average, on a road surface on which an average actual light irradiation is actively performed. Thus, the herbicide mixture has an advantage in that a synergistic effect is obtained during use (which cannot be expected to compare the case of a single drug in which diquat dibromide and glufosinate ammonium are separately used). In particular, due to a difference in the action mechanisms of diquat dibromide and glufosinate ammonium, diquat dibromide, at the same time, allows for drug efficacy following treatment to be promptly exhibited, and glufosinate ammonium allows for weeds in shaded areas without sunshine to be removed. Further, since the combined drug has a duration of efficacy of at least 30 days, as well as a fast-acting property exhibited within a day after treatment, after one control application, there is no need to use a herbicide for a long period of time. Thus, the combined drug is effective in reducing the amount of agricultural chemicals that would otherwise be used.
